This is a macbook air with Intel HD Graphics 3000.  I'm running Precise
Pangolin 64-bit. I haven't installed anything for graphics card support.
I'm using Gnome Shell.

The second monitor works on the login screen.  However, after logging in
it will immediately freeze with background images hap-hazardly repeated
across all monitors and nothing else going on.  If I let it log in first
and then plug in the monitor, the screens both go black and a single
cursor is visible on the second monitor, but it wont move.  In both
situations, the only way to escape is to cut the power, since nothing is
interactive anymore.
